Replace the rotors or can they be machined?

Well, I have an 06 4.4 with 57k on it and the rear pads and sensor need to be replaced. I have replaced the pads on my 01 530i and my 95 M3 before. Well, I have researched the forum and have read a few things in other places, but can't really seem to find something about if i can get the rear rotors machined? I have heard the rotors will be fine if I have enough of it left, 10.5 I beleive. However, the dealer says replace them fully. I obviously want to do it right and at the same time, not waste money if I don't have to. I have gone to a "popular" bmw part store online and they are looking at 108 for each rotor. An auto parts store will machine each rotor for 15 bucks. I have the time, but I need a few opinions here. The stealer said 644 bucks for rear pads, rotors and the sensor. lol. what a joke.
